The Licence That Isn’t What It Claims
DaVinci Gold Casino operates under SSC Entertainment N.V. and reports a Curacao licence number #8048/JAZ. That number cannot be matched to a current public regulator record. Casino Guru flags the Curacao line as fake. No UKGC account number exists. For UK players, that means no UK regulatory protections, no mandatory 10x wagering cap that came into force in January 2026, and no direct complaint route to the Gambling Commission. The licence claim is the first red flag, and it colours everything else.
Bonus Terms That Bite Back
The welcome bonus structure is deliberately vague. The operator’s public config lists a 200% deposit promotion, 100% cashback, and 30% next-day cashback, but the detailed terms never appear in the fetched HTML. One Trustpilot reply from April 2026 confirms a 50x wagering requirement on a small win. Here is what that means in real numbers:
- A 200% match on a £25 deposit gives you £75 total to play with
- At 50x wagering on the bonus only, you need to turnover £2,500 before withdrawal
- If wagering applies to deposit plus bonus, the turnover jumps to £3,750
- Maximum cashout caps can reduce any win further
The 75 free spins offer is visually clear but terms-light. Until you see the full wagering base, spin value, expiry, and maximum cashout inside your account, treat it as marketing copy rather than a guaranteed offer.
Withdrawals: The Real Problem
Banking is where DaVinci Gold Casino fails hardest. The operator’s own config shows a 12-day withdrawal value. AskGamblers lists pending times of 1-7 days with daily and weekly caps. Casino Guru flags a £500 weekly limit. The complaint record tells the story:
- One unresolved case: a €3,023 bonus and withdrawal dispute
- Another unresolved: a $250 Bitcoin deposit followed by an account lock
- A third: a $401 withdrawal delay after documents were already approved
- Multiple cases: repeated document-review delays and queue language
These are not isolated incidents. They form a pattern of friction around payouts that makes DaVinci Gold unsuitable for anyone who needs predictable, timely withdrawals.
Game Library: Rival Nostalgia With Limits
The game collection is recognisably Rival-led. You get i-Slots with story mechanics, table games, video poker, and live casino titles from providers including Rival, Fugaso, Felix Gaming, and Betsoft. AskGamblers names specific Rival titles like Gold Bricks and Diamond Cherries. The library is broad enough for casual sessions, but it cannot compensate for the safety issues. Casino Guru gives the site a 3.0/10 Safety Index despite calling it a very big casino by estimated size.
What Players Actually Report
Sentiment splits hard across platforms. Trustpilot shows 4.4/5 with many positive reviews about promotions and quick support. But the negative reviews are specific and damning: one UK player says a £45 payout has not been paid for over a year. Another describes a $2,500 rollover on a $50 win. Casino Guru records 16 complaints about DaVinci Gold and related brands. AskGamblers gives it 1/10 CasinoRank with 10 complaints, 4 unresolved.
| Platform | Score | Key Issue |
|---|---|---|
| Casino Guru | 3.0/10 Safety Index | Fake licence, unfair terms, low withdrawal limit |
| AskGamblers | 1/10 CasinoRank | Terminated status, unresolved payment disputes |
| Trustpilot | 4.4/5 | Positive headline, but recent one-star reviews describe payout failures |
